System and method for creating markers on scroll bars of a graphical user interface
First Claim
1. A method for scrolling using a scroll bar of an electronic file having end points, comprising:
- defining at least one graphical marker on the scroll bar other than one of the end points; and
allowing a user to scroll to the at least one graphical marker;
wherein at least one of the graphical markers comprises a dissolving stub point marker located on a portion of the scroll bar for referencing a particular location in the file that is configured to automatically dissolve after the user reaches the particular location in the file referenced by the dissolving stub point marker.

Abstract
The present invention is embodied in a system and method for creating markers on scroll bars of a graphical user interface. Basically, the present invention allows users to reference locations of interest within a document using scroll bars of a user interface by creating graphical halt and pause points on the scroll bar at the locations of interest. In general, the present invention includes a user interface with a digital document of an application being used by a user. The application has at least a vertical scroll bar for moving from one location to another within the digital document. The scroll bar includes a scroll box, stub points and end points. The stub points represent reference points within the digital document that are predefined by the user. The stub points either stop or pause the movement of the scroll box as it moves along the scroll bar. The end points represent the top and bottom portion of the digital document.
